怎样获取安卓app的应用签名文件

获取安卓应用的签名文件是开发或测试安卓应用时经常需要的步骤之一,签名文件用于确认应用的身份和完整性。本文将详细介绍如何获取安卓应用的签名文件。

签名文件的作用是确保应用的身份和完整性,同时也是应用发布到Google Play等应用商店所必需的文件。签名文件由开发者生成,用于对应用进行数字签名,以证明应用来源的可靠性。

获取签名文件的方法有多种,下面分别介绍使用Android Studio和命令行工具的获取方式。

一、使用Android Studio获取签名文件:

1. 打开Android Studio,并打开你的项目。

2. 在菜单栏中,选择“Build” -> “Generate Signed Bundle / APK”。

3. 在弹出的对话框中,选择“APK”并点击“Next”。

4. 在下一个界面选择“Create new”或者“Choose existing”来选择签名文件的存储位置。如果是第一次生成签名文件,请选择“Create new”。如果之前已经生成过签名文件,则可以选择“Choose existing”并导入现有的签名文件。

5. 填写签名文件的信息,包括:Keystore路径、Keystore密码、别名以及别名密码。当填写完信息后,点击“Next”。

6. 在下一个界面选择“debug”或者“release”模式。如果是用于测试目的,选择“debug”模式;如果是用于发布到应用商店,选择“release”模式,并填写相应的版本号、版本名等信息。

7. 点击“Finish”,签名文件将会生成在选择的存储位置。

二、使用命令行工具获取签名文件:

1. 打开命令行终端。

2. 使用以下命令进入到你的项目根目录:

```

cd path_to_your_project

```

3. 执行以下命令来生成签名文件:

```

keytool -genkey -v -keystore keystore.jks -keyalg RSA -keysize 2048 -validity 10000 -alias your_alias_name

```

其中,`path_to_your_project`是你的项目路径,`keystore.jks`是签名文件的文件名,`your_alias_name`是签名文件的别名。

4. 执行以上命令后,会要求你输入一些必要信息,包括:存储密码、别名密码、姓名、单位名称等。根据提示逐步填写即可。

5. 完成以上步骤后,签名文件将会生成在你的项目根目录下。

无论是使用Android Studio还是命令行工具,生成的签名文件都应该妥善保管,并在需要的时候使用。同时,注意签名文件的安全性,避免泄露给不可信任的人员。

总结:本文详细介绍了如何获取安卓应用的签名文件。通过Android Studio或者命令行工具可以轻松生成签名文件,并确保应用的身份和完整性。获取到签名文件后,请妥善保管,并注意签名文件的安全性。